Knox County, Tenn. – The Knox County Health Department launched a new webpage (https://www.knoxcounty.org/health/neat/neat_recipes.php) featuring more than 60 recipes to promote healthy eating. More recipes will be added in the coming months. The website allows users to filter recipes by season and cuisine. Tennessee Wildlife Resources Agency is emphasizing the importance of keeping exotic pets properly contained after officers find an escaped pet porcupine in Knoxville. Tennessee Valley Authority says they will still able to meet demands despite having three nuclear reactors offline. TVA spokesperson Scott Brooks says there is a reactor offline at each of TVA’s three nuclear plants. Morgan County Sheriff Wayne Potter has died after his battle with cancer. Officials with Morgan County Sheriff’s Department say he died early today (Tuesday) surrounded by his family. The McNabb Center will celebrate the groundbreaking of its Blount County Transition Campus on Friday, February 21, 2025, at 2 p.m. This residential complex will be the first of its kind in the state allowing clients with co-occurring disorders to receive a full range of re-entry services. The Federal Emergency Management Agency will cover 75% of the cost to rebuild Conway Bridge, a historic structure in Cocke County.
